Kaliuwa’a Falls is a multistage falls totaling over 1,100 feet high and is located along the Kaluanui stream in Hau’ula, Oahu. This video shows only the 80-foot stage which is accessible by foot. On Mother’s Day (May 9) in 1999, a landslide resulted in many deaths and injuries, prompting the State of Hawaii to close the trail until today.
